Our harvesting and canning is pretty much non-stop right now... The new freeze dryer has been running non-stop since we got it a couple weeks back... We've been freeze drying mostly blackberries and squash/zucchini. We started with the berries we already had in the freezer... Can get about 25 pounds per load, but it takes about 40 hours to do a load of blackberries! Those jokers have a lot of water in them apparently.

Charlie, do you shade them mater plants someway or do they pull out of that wilt easy? Mine will be dead before too long, the weather liar says we gonna hit 109 Sunday.
Jeff, I've been pouring the water to 'em morning and evening, but they're taking a serious hit right now. Most of our maters are "determinate" varieties, so they basically produce their fruits then quit anyway... We were about 2-3 weeks late in getting them planted, but they made their crop I think... Will start harvesting them in earnest here shortly. Lots of color showing all over the patch this morning... Next year though I will have some kind of shade system ready! Even my peppers are beginning to get sun scald, especially the sweets like the bell peppers...
